-/**
- * Yaml offers convenience methods to load and dump YAML.
- *
- * @author Fabien Potencier <fabien@symfony.com>
- *
- * @api
- */
-class Yaml
-{
- /**
- * Parses YAML into a PHP array.
- *
- * The parse method, when supplied with a YAML stream (string or file),
- * will do its best to convert YAML in a file into a PHP array.
- *
- * Usage:
- * <code>
- * $array = Yaml::parse('config.yml');
- * print_r($array);
- * </code>
- *
- * As this method accepts both plain strings and file names as an input,
- * you must validate the input before calling this method. Passing a file
- * as an input is a deprecated feature and will be removed in 3.0.
- *
- * @param string $input Path to a YAML file or a string containing YAML
- * @param bool $exceptionOnInvalidType True if an exception must be thrown on invalid types false otherwise
- * @param bool $objectSupport True if object support is enabled, false otherwise
- *
- * @return array The YAML converted to a PHP array
- *
- * @throws ParseException If the YAML is not valid
- *
- * @api
- */
- public static function parse($input, $exceptionOnInvalidType = false, $objectSupport = false)
- {
- // if input is a file, process it
- $file = '';
- if (strpos($input, "\n") === false && is_file($input)) {
- if (false === is_readable($input)) {
- throw new ParseException(sprintf('Unable to parse "%s" as the file is not readable.', $input));
- }
-
- $file = $input;
- $input = file_get_contents($file);
- }
-
- $yaml = new Parser();
-
- try {
- return $yaml->parse($input, $exceptionOnInvalidType, $objectSupport);
- } catch (ParseException $e) {
- if ($file) {
- $e->setParsedFile($file);
- }
-
- throw $e;
- }
- }
-
- /**
- * Dumps a PHP array to a YAML string.
- *
- * The dump method, when supplied with an array, will do its best
- * to convert the array into friendly YAML.
- *
- * @param array $array PHP array
- * @param int $inline The level where you switch to inline YAML
- * @param int $indent The amount of spaces to use for indentation of nested nodes.
- * @param bool $exceptionOnInvalidType true if an exception must be thrown on invalid types (a PHP resource or object), false otherwise
- * @param bool $objectSupport true if object support is enabled, false otherwise
- *
- * @return string A YAML string representing the original PHP array
- *
- * @api
- */
- public static function dump($array, $inline = 2, $indent = 4, $exceptionOnInvalidType = false, $objectSupport = false)
- {
- $yaml = new Dumper();
- $yaml->setIndentation($indent);
-
- return $yaml->dump($array, $inline, 0, $exceptionOnInvalidType, $objectSupport);
- }
-}
